Diabetic Foot Ulcer Biologics Market 2030: Aging Populations Fuel DFU Demand
The global diabetic foot ulcer biologics market is experiencing strong growth as the prevalence of diabetes and its complications continues to rise across the world. In 2024, the market was estimated at approximately USD 2.01 billion and is projected to grow at a compound annual growth rate (CAGR) of 7.9% from 2025 to 2030, reaching an estimated USD 3.11 billion by 2030. This growth is driven by increasing rates of chronic diabetic foot ulcers (DFUs), a growing geriatric population, and ongoing advancements in biologic therapies designed to enhance wound healing. Biologics play a crucial role in managing severe and non-healing wounds by promoting tissue regeneration and reducing infection risks—factors that are critical as healthcare systems globally emphasize early intervention and improved patient outcomes.
Multiple demographic and clinical trends are supporting the expansion of this market. As populations age, particularly in developed regions, the incidence of diabetes-related complications such as foot ulcers increases due to sustained hyperglycemia and associated vascular impairments. These ulcers often require advanced wound care beyond conventional treatments, positioning biologics as essential therapeutic options. Key Market Trends & Insights
- Rapid innovation in biologics technology is improving clinical outcomes for DFU patients, with products designed to enhance tissue repair and accelerate wound closure.
- Skin substitutes dominated the product segment in 2024, capturing a significant share due to strong clinical evidence supporting their effectiveness for treating complex and severe ulcers.
- Tissue-engineered products are projected to grow at the fastest rate among product types, reflecting rising demand for next-generation wound healing solutions.
- Neuro-ischemic ulcers held the largest share by indication in 2024, underscoring the clinical challenges associated with vascular and nerve damage in diabetic patients.
- Hospitals remained the leading end-use segment in 2024, due to their capacity to manage complex wound care cases and adopt advanced biologic treatments.
- North America accounted for the largest regional market share in 2024, supported by advanced healthcare infrastructure and higher adoption rates of innovative therapies.
- Emerging markets, particularly in the Asia Pacific region, are showing strong growth potential, driven by increasing diabetes prevalence and healthcare investment.

Market Size & Forecast
- The diabetic foot ulcer biologics market was valued at approximately USD 2.01 billion in 2024.
- It is expected to grow to around USD 2.13 billion in 2025, reflecting the beginning of robust growth driven by rising demand for advanced therapies.
- By 2030, the market is projected to reach approximately USD 3.11 billion, growing at a CAGR of 7.9% from 2025 to 2030.
- North America is forecast to retain the largest share over the projection period, supported by greater adoption of biologic treatments, supportive reimbursement frameworks, and strong clinical evidence adoption.
- Asia Pacific and other emerging regions are expected to register faster growth rates, driven by increasing diabetic populations and expanding access to healthcare services.
